150.M101. Germain's Swiftlet  Aerodramus germani 

756566997_GermainsSwiftlet-1.jpg.ac75b7cd92b6a0342ea958e308fcdf7c.jpg

Langkawi         22.02.2020

1781491551_GermainsSwiftlet-2.jpg.8e7e71dfcb5401c8a7d72fce2ea4b0e4.jpg

Penang            26.02.2020

These were very common in some areas. The nests are used in Birds' Nest Soup. Rather than raiding nests in caves, local people build what are called "Swift Houses" - quite large buildings of similar size to a human house.  There are entrances for the swiftlets, and they nest inside. The nests are collected  after the babies fledge.
